PREDICTION MODELS FOR SHRINKAGE OF CONCRETE - OVERVIEW, CLASSIFICATION AND COMPARISON

 Summary:
 In assessment of the future behavior of a designed concrete structure, the data on the time development of strains due to shrinkage of concrete is of particular importance. The selection of an appropriate prediction method and model for concrete shrinkage will affect the accuracy of the estimation, but also the duration and cost of the design. In order to facilitate this selection, this paper presents the fields of application, factors that are considered, the classification and the basic equations for four frequently used prediction models for shrinkage of concrete: ACI 209, GL 2000, MC 2010 and B4. The results obtained by application of these models on a few examples from literature are compared and discussed.
